WDC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2016 in Review

714 of the 4,000 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Western Digital (WDC) for Q4 2016, worth a combined $16.7B — up 14% from $14.7B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 143 funds opened new WDC positions and 61 closed out — a net gain of 82 holders — while 238 added to existing stakes and 265 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Iridian Asset Management, adding an estimated $97.6M. The largest seller was American International Group, cutting an estimated $608M.
